The Army Contracting Command-Redstone Arsenal-Corpus Christi Army Depot, Contracting Office in Corpus Christi, Texas is issuing a sources sought as a means of conducting market research to identify potential sources that can provide A batch waste treatment support structure in accordance with the requirement contained herein. The result of this market research will contribute to determining the method of procurement.
Based on the responses to this sources sought notice/market research, this requirement may be set-aside for small business or procured through full and open competition. SPECIFIC TASKS 5.1 Basic Services: The Contractor shall provide services for design, fabrication and installation of a batch treatment tank support structure to include an adjacent personnel platform in conformance to the specification in 5.2.
5.2 Task/Requirement:
5.2.1 Design: The contractor shall design a tank support structure that meets the performance criteria as specified in the Batch Treatment Tank Support Structure specification in Attachment 7 of this PWS. The Batch Treatment Tank Support Structure design shall include the calculated design loads, materials of construction, and fabrication drawings.
5.2.2 Fabrication: The Contractor shall remove the existing support structure in the batch wastewater treatment facility in B340, dispose of existing support structure in accordance with Federal, State, and local regulations, and fabricate the new structure for installation in the batch wastewater treatment facility. The Contractor shall fabricate a tank support structure that meets the performance criteria as specified in the Batch Treatment Tank Support Structure specification in Attachment 7 of this PWS.
5.2.3 Installation: The contractor shall install the new support structure in the batch wastewater treatment facility
